A rough and quick method to find out skills one has adapted while working are:
Make a list of all your past jobs and activities undertaken till date.
Write detailed information about each task performed in job or activities.
Write each skill learnt and used in performing those tasks.
For self assessment a person may pose following questions:
Who am I? What are my skills? It is a journey to know oneself. Better knowledge and awareness about oneself helps in taking right career decision.
Where do I want to go? It is comparatively easy to identify what one does not or may not want to do but it is hard finding exactly what one can do. Once it is identified, a person can easily target his/her choice of industry, organizations or companies.
How do I get there? The first step is to set the goal, assess oneself and then plan how to attain that goal. It may require adding few more skills.

To correctly identify one's career path, one has to know his/ her skills. A person can take various career tests such a Personality Type Test, Interest and Career Choices Test etc. It will help a person to identify not only his/her skills but also his/her personality, interest that make it easier to identify the career and job choices.
One of the challenges with self assessment is that a person may feel discouraged by the result of self evaluation. Resultantly he loses his Self esteem. One should take self assessment test only to self verify and use the information for self enhancement.
Other challenge is wrong assessment of oneself. Which will lead to wrong assessment of all others things? While taking self assessment test one should be patient and take time to assess oneself.
Self assessment has a major role in finding the career path but it should only be used for selecting right career and self enhancement.
